Organizational Overview

Synchronys Chief Data Office (CDO) is a team of data management and analytics professionals dedicated to improving customer and partner experiences and optimizing business performance. We enable enterprise data strategy through strong data governance and management practices.

Role Summary/Purpose

The AVP, Analytics Data Steward supports enterprise Data Governance, data privacy and data transmission operations by partnering with Risk (i.e., Legal/Compliance) and IT stakeholders (i.e., Information Security) to operationalize governance standards and controls across the organization. The role enables consistent data handling practices through stewardship support, process execution, training, and documentation, and provides analytics and reporting to monitor throughput, quality, compliance, and program adoption. This position contributes to risk reduction and regulatory readiness by supporting PII data discovery governance, outbound data sharing oversight, consumer rights (e.g., DSAR) process enablement, issue triage and remediation coordination, and maintenance of audit-ready evidence and documentation.

Key Responsibilities
  • Support the Data Governance Team to expand program adoption across Synchrony through communication, training, and support of the oversight community, including training/workshop coordination and stewardship support.
  • Support PII data discovery and scoping operations (where applicable), including scan monitoring/triage, exception management, and coordination of remediation actions with responsible teams.
  • Support consumer rights / DSAR operational processes (as applicable), including fulfillment of CCPA/CPRA right-to-access and right-to-erasure requests in alignment with internal Privacy OLAs.
  • Support outbound data sharing governance with third parties by managing the request process and overseeing the workflow, expediting emergency requests, supporting process questions/issues, and ensuring timely progression through required approvals.
  • Communicate requirements for workflow enhancements with the Data Sourcing team and conduct UAT testing of workflow changes as well as the impact of platform upgrades
  • Routinely engage with the Supplier Management, Legal, and Information Security teams to support timely risk assessment coordination, issue resolution, and completion of required approvals.
  • Support governance automation and workflow optimization initiatives to reduce manual effort in risk intake, assessment, tracking, and reporting.
  • Develop and maintain governance analytics and reporting, including operational and risk KPIs/KRIs, dashboarding, and executive summaries of operational throughput, compliance, remediation progress, and program adoption.
  • Identify process efficiencies/deficiencies using data and operational insights; produce recommendations, propose control enhancements, and support implementation of process improvements AND standardization.
  • Participate in the analysis of platform defects and data issues; support triage, root cause documentation, remediating planning and execution tracking.
  • Manage the development, enhancement and standardization of governance documentation (policies, procedures, playbooks, job aids) and training materials; review training completion/usage statistics and recommend enablement improvements.
